Explore Bangkok’s Family Attractions
The capital city, Bangkok, has plenty of entertainment for children and adults alike.
Top Family Spots in Bangkok
- Visit Safari World for animal shows and safari rides.
- Spend a day at SEA LIFE Bangkok Ocean World, one of Southeast Asia’s largest aquariums.
- Enjoy thrilling rides at Dream World.
- Take a relaxing dinner cruise on the Chao Phraya River.
- Explore interactive museums like Children's Discovery Museum.
Enjoy Beach Fun in Phuket
Phuket is ideal for families who love beaches and water activities.
Family Activities in Phuket
- Build sandcastles and swim at Kata or Kamala Beach.
- Visit Phuket FantaSea for cultural performances and entertainment.
- Try island hopping tours suitable for families.
- Enjoy snorkeling in calm waters.
- Visit ethical elephant sanctuaries for close wildlife experiences.
Visit Chiang Mai for Nature & Culture
Chiang Mai offers a calmer atmosphere perfect for family adventures.
What Families Love in Chiang Mai
- Feed and interact with rescued elephants at ethical sanctuaries.
- Take a Thai cooking class designed for families.
- Explore mountain villages and waterfalls.
- Visit night markets for local snacks and souvenirs.
- Experience traditional Thai festivals and lantern events.

Family Island Adventures
Thailand’s islands are perfect for boat trips and family relaxation.
Recommended Islands
- Phi Phi Islands for scenic boat tours.
- Koh Samui for luxury family resorts.
- Koh Lanta for peaceful beaches.
- Krabi for kayaking and nature tours.
Tips for Families Traveling in Thailand
- Travel between November and March for pleasant weather.
- Choose family-friendly hotels with kids’ clubs and pools.
- Carry sunscreen, hats, and mosquito repellent.
- Use private transfers for easier travel with children.
- Keep snacks and water handy during sightseeing.
